titleOfInvention Aluminium oxide forming nickel based alloy
abstract The nickel-based alloy for use at a high temperature preferably has a C content of 0.05 to 0.2, a maximum of Si of 1.5, a maximum of Mn of 0.5, a Cr of 15 to 20, an Al of 4 to 6, a Fe of 15 to 25, a maximum of Co of 10 and a N of 0.03 to 0.15 At most 0.5, at least one element selected from the group consisting of 0.25 to 2.2 at least one element selected from the group consisting of Ta, Zr, Hf, Ti and Nb, at least 0.5 elements selected from the group consisting of REM, Containing impurities.
